Technical specifications Model Lenovo TB-8703F Lenovo TB-8703X CPU Qualcomm APQ8053 Qualcomm MSM8953 Battery 4250mAh 4250mAh Wireless communication Bluetooth 4.0; WLAN 802.11 a/b/g/n/ac GPS/GLONASS Bluetooth 4.0; WLAN 802.11 a/b/g/n/ac GPS/GLONASS; FDD -LTE/TDDLTE/UMTS/GSM Note: Lenovo TB-8703X supports LTE Band 1, 3, 5, 7, 8, 20, 38 and 40. But in some countries, LTE is not supported. To know if your device works with LTE networks in your country, contact your carrier.

Force shutdown/reboot Please hold down the On/Off button for about 8 seconds to shutdown the device or hold down the On/Off button for about 10 seconds to restart the device.

Sync You can transfer data between your device and computer. Transfer music, pictures, videos, documents, Android application package (APK) files, and so on. Connecting your device and computer Connect your device and computer with a data line. Slide down from the top of the screen, you will see "USB computer connection " in the notification bar. Tap USB computer connection for other options.
Selecting computer connection mode You can select one of the following options: Media device (MTP) : Select this mode if you want to transfer media files such as photos, videos, and ringtones between your tablet and the computer. Camera (PTP) : Select this mode if you want to transfer only photos and videos between your tablet and the computer. Only charge: Select this mode if you want to charge your phone only.

Warning: exposure to loud noise from any source for extended periods of time may affect your hearing. The louder the sound, the less time is required before your hearing could be affected. To protect your hearing: Limit the amount of time you use headsets or headphones at high volume. Avoid turning up the volume to block out noisy surroundings. Turn the volume down if you can't hear people speaking near you.
Be aware of heat generated by your device When your device is turned on or the battery is charging, some parts might become hot. The temperature that they reach depends on the amount of system activity and the battery charge level. Extended contact with your body, even through clothing, could cause discomfort or even a skin burn. Avoid keeping your hands, your lap, or any other part of your body in contact with a hot section of the device for any extended time.
